Choosing the Right Pillow: A Guide to Style and Comfort
Selecting the perfect indoor pillow involves considering several factors, including size, shape, fabric, and color. Let's break down the options to help you make the best choice for your space.
Size and Shape: Finding the Perfect Fit
The size and shape of your pillow will significantly impact its visual appeal and comfort.
- Square Pillows: A classic choice, square pillows like those in 20x20 or 18x18 sizes are versatile and work well on sofas, chairs, and beds.
- Lumbar Pillows: These rectangular pillows offer excellent back support and add a touch of elegance to any seating arrangement.
- Round Pillows: A fun and unexpected choice, round pillows can soften the lines of a room and add a playful touch.
- Euro Shams: Large square pillows, often 26x26 inches, add a luxurious and sophisticated feel to beds, especially when layered behind standard pillows.
- Floor Pillows: Oversized and comfortable, floor pillows create a casual and inviting seating option, perfect for kids' rooms or bohemian-inspired spaces.
Consider the size of your furniture and the overall proportions of your room when choosing pillow sizes. A large sofa can handle multiple large pillows, while a smaller chair might only need one or two smaller cushions.
Fabric plays a crucial role in both the look and feel of your indoor pillows.
- Velvet: Luxurious and soft, velvet pillows add a touch of glamour to any space.
- Linen: A natural and breathable fabric, linen pillows offer a relaxed and casual vibe.
- Cotton: Durable and easy to care for, cotton pillows are a practical choice for everyday use.
- Textured Fabrics: Pillows with textured surfaces, like woven or embroidered designs, add visual interest and depth to your decor.
Color is another essential consideration.
- White and Grey: Neutral colors like white and grey offer a clean and modern look that complements any style.
- Blue and Green: These calming colors bring a touch of nature indoors and create a relaxing atmosphere.
- Geometric and Floral Patterns: These patterns add personality and visual interest to your space.
- Striped and Bohemian: These patterns are great for adding a fun and energetic feel to a room.
Beyond Decoration: The Practical Benefits of Indoor Pillows
Indoor pillows aren't just for show. They also offer practical benefits that can enhance your comfort and well-being.
- Support and Comfort: Whether you're lounging on the sofa or reading in bed, indoor pillows provide essential support for your back and neck.
- Hypoallergenic Options: If you have allergies, look for hypoallergenic pillows filled with down alternative materials.
- Easy Maintenance: Choose pillows with removable covers and zipper closures for easy washing and cleaning. Consider stain-resistant or waterproof options for high-traffic areas or homes with children and pets.
- Versatility: From accent pillows to throw pillows, you can easily change the look of a room by swapping out your indoor pillows.

Q: What are the best materials for indoor pillows if I have pets or children?
A: For homes with pets or children, durable and easy-to-clean materials are ideal! Look for indoor pillows with removable and washable covers made from fabrics like cotton, linen blends, or performance materials. These options are both stylish and practical, ensuring your pillows stay beautiful for years to come.
